Hunan Bridge Collapse Death Toll Climbs to 41
Adjust font size:

The death toll from the bridge collapse in central China's Hunan Province rose to 41 on Thursday as rescuers prepared to blast the rubble to make it easier to clear.

Up to 80 holes are to be dug in the collapsed piers for explosives.

Experts believe the chances of finding survivors are slim after three days since its collapse.

The 328-meter-long, 42-meter-high Tuojiang River Bridge in Fenghuang County, in western Hunan Province, collapsed on Monday afternoon when an estimated 123 workers were dismantling steel scaffolding.

Sixty-four workers escaped or were pulled from the debris and rescuers are still searching for around two dozen people thought to be buried.

The four-arch bridge was to link Fenghuang County, a popular tourist spot, with Daxing Airport in Tongren City, neighboring Guizhou Province.

Construction began in March 2004 and the bridge was scheduled to open to traffic at the end of the month.

A nine-member team of experts has arrived at the site to take samples from the rubble to determine whether the construction had quality problems.

Meanwhile, an investigation team under the State Council, headed by Li Yizhong, director of the State Administration of Work Safety, has been formed with officials from the communications, construction, health and supervision ministries.

Li ordered a thorough investigation and strict punishment of those responsible for the tragedy.

(Xinhua News Agency August 16, 2007)
